Hi Joss,

Leaving you the box of score sheets from the Varnlow regional chess final — all 140 games, sorted by round. The federation wants the originals untouched until their arbiter reviews two disputed results, so please don't let anyone photocopy them. A courier from Tillane Express collects the box Monday morning. When they show up, follow the hand-over instruction just below.

handover note for kageg-bajog: the fenion zorael courier leaves the wenax eliath wenix druvan eliion ulawyn kelys quenax ledger at gate 1070 under passcode 936556

Step 3: Patch the image cache. Brindlepic 2.4 fixes the leak where evicted thumbnails kept byte buffers pinned via the resize pool. Upgrade the cache library, restart the render workers one at a time, and confirm heap usage plateaus within an hour. Then mark the migration complete in the ops tracker using the connection string below.

primary connection of yagep-kahip = redis://giliel_svc:zYiKsLL2PLpfPL@db-348f.xolmarsys.corp:5432/fenwyn

**Mgmt Meeting Minutes — Retiring the Brightline Range**

Quick recap for sales leads at Fenholt Supplies: we agreed to retire the Brightline fixture range by year-end. Remaining stock moves to clearance pricing next month, and accounts on standing orders get migrated to the Lumetta range. Trade-in incentives were approved in principle. The confidential note on next steps sits just below.

board note of bajof-bajeg: The pricing group signed off on a budget of $13.4 million for Project Sildor. The renewal with Lamixek Holdings closes at $48.9 million a year, 49 percent above the last contract.

## Pennant Telemetry — Environments

The Pennant collector compresses telemetry payloads before shipping them upstream. Staging and production use different compression levels and batch sizes, which is the usual cause of size-mismatch alerts when comparing environments. Contractors should never change these directly; file a change request instead. Each environment's active compression and batching settings are recorded below.

service settings:
[julox]
host = julox.lumicio.example
user = julox_svc
database = julox_prod